🔍 Как стать junior python разработчиком: советы и рекомендации
Как стать Junior Python?
Чтобы стать Junior Python разработчиком, вам понадобятся следующие шаги:
- Изучите основы Python: Начните с основ языка Python, таких как синтаксис, переменные, типы данных и управляющие конструкции.
- Пишите код: Напишите простые программы, чтобы практиковаться в программировании на Python. Это поможет вам улучшить свои навыки и закрепить пройденный материал.
- Изучите основные библиотеки: Ознакомьтесь с популярными библиотеками, используемыми в разработке на Python, такими как NumPy, Pandas и Flask. Изучение этих библиотек поможет расширить вашу базу знаний и улучшить вашу эффективность в разработке.
- Проекты: Разработайте свои собственные проекты, которые позволят вам применить полученные знания на практике. Создание проектов позволит вам продемонстрировать свои навыки потенциальным работодателям.
- Самостоятельное обучение и изучение лучших практик: Следите за последними трендами в мире Python, изучайте новые возможности языка и разбирайтесь с лучшими практиками разработки на Python.
Пример простого кода на Python:
# Пример программы для сложения двух чисел
a = 10
b = 5
с = a + b
print(с)
Детальный ответ
Как стать Junior Python
Привет! Если вы хотите начать свою карьеру в программировании и заинтересовались Python, то вы выбрали отличный язык для начала. Python - это простой, читаемый и мощный язык программирования, который широко используется в различных областях разработки программного обеспечения.
Шаг 1: Основы Python
Первый и самый важный шаг, чтобы стать Junior Python, - это освоить основы самого языка. Узнайте синтаксис Python, его основные структуры данных и операторы. Пройдите интерактивные курсы, примеры онлайн-кода и практикуйтесь, чтобы стать более уверенным синтаксически.
# Пример кода
print("Привет, мир!")
Шаг 2: Потренируйтесь на задачах
Чтобы стать уверенным Junior Python, важно решать практические задачи. Проблема решения реальных задач поможет вам улучшить свои навыки программирования и логическое мышление. Решайте задачи на алгоритмы, создавайте маленькие проекты и участвуйте в программных конкурсах - все это поможет вам стать более опытным разработчиком.
# Пример кода для решения задачи - поиск максимального числа в списке
numbers = [4, 9, 2, 7, 5]
max_number = max(numbers)
print("Максимальное число:", max_number)
Шаг 3: Основы объектно-ориентированного программирования (ООП)
Python поддерживает объектно-ориентированное программирование (ООП), что делает его мощным инструментом для разработки программного обеспечения. Изучите основы ООП, такие как классы, объекты, наследование и инкапсуляцию. Практикуйтесь в создании классов и объектов, чтобы лучше понять эту концепцию.
# Пример кода для создания класса в Python
class Car:
def __init__(self, brand, model):
self.brand = brand
self.model = model
def info(self):
return f"Марка: {self.brand}, Модель: {self.model}"
car1 = Car("Toyota", "Corolla")
print(car1.info())
Шаг 4: Работа с библиотеками
Python имеет множество полезных библиотек, которые могут значительно упростить разработку. Изучите некоторые популярные библиотеки, такие как NumPy для научных вычислений, Pandas для обработки данных и Django для веб-разработки. Работа с реальными проектами, использующими эти библиотеки, поможет вам улучшить свои навыки и понимание их работы.
# Пример кода с использованием библиотеки NumPy
import numpy as np
array = np.array([1, 2, 3, 4, 5])
mean = np.mean(array)
print("Среднее значение:", mean)
Шаг 5: Продолжайте учиться и улучшайтесь
Процесс становления Junior Python никогда не заканчивается. Всегда продолжайте учиться, искать новые проекты и задачи, делиться своими успехами с сообществом разработчиков. Если вы находите свою страсть в программировании, вы можете стать успешным Python разработчиком.
Удачи в изучении Python и становлении Junior разработчиком!